    • Chicago Mercantile Exchange

      Jan 1987 - Jan 1994
      Managing Director, Asia Pacific

      As the only employee of both the CME and the Chicago Board of Trade (CBOT) prior to the merger of the exchanges, headed business development for the joint Asia / Pacific office.• Merged the two offices of CME and CBOT, saving the exchanges $2M annually.• Instrumental in increasing by about 900% the volume of Japanese users of these markets. Grew the Asian exchange memberships from zero to about 20% of the total exchanges’ memberships.• Introduced the first non-Japanese trading terminals in Japan by negotiating with the Ministry of Finance. • Developed Malaysia’s futures brokerage certification exam in a consulting contract between CME and the Malaysian authorities.• Invited by the Chinese authorities in 1989 with subsequent further invitations, instructed them on how to establish and manage a futures exchange. Watched and advised the emergence of China’s first commodity futures markets and then the evolution into the current structure of three commodity exchanges and one financial futures exchange.
